Subject vs Objects
Remember that SUBJECTS usually go before verbs, and OBJECTS normally go after verbs. We can use gerunds (ING forms) as Subjects and Objects in a sentence.
I love pizza
Subject
Object
VERB
Playing games helps me concentrate.
KarIa loves playing games.
